Interesting that you should ask, as I had often wondered about this myself. There are two hypotheses regarding this:
1. The glands continuously generate and "pump" fluid through the ducts & into the urethra as the woman ejaculates.
2. A section of the bladder fills with "prostatic" fluid during sexual arousal, and the glands pump from this reservoir during ejaculation. An experiment testing this hypothesis involved completely emptying the bladder with a catheter prior to arousal, then using ultrasound to watch for fluid. The scan seemed to verify the researcher's hypothesis, but much more research is necessary to confirm these findings.
Either way, the chemical composition of female ejaculate leaves no doubt as to whether it is urine. (NO!)
